浏览 11978 次
精华帖 (0) :: 良好帖 (0) :: 新手帖 (0) :: 隐藏帖 (0)
|
|
---|---|
作者 | 正文 |
发表时间:2010-07-20
最后修改:2010-10-23
1、进入cmd手动停止mysql服务:net stop mysql 2、卸载MySQL 4、删除原来安装的目录Mysql 5、重新安装Mysql,问题解决完毕,祝您好运
之前的解决方法有点误会。( 1.进入cmd手动停止mysql服务:net stop mysql。 2.修改C:\Program Files\MySQL\MySQL Server 5.1\ 目录下的my.ini文件,在[mysqld]下添加 3.在cmd中启动mysql服务:net start mysql 4、打开mysql直接按回车以空密码登录 5、退出mysql,停止mysql服务:net stop mysql 6、将第2步添加的skip-grant-tables语句删掉 7、启动mysql服务:net start mysql 8、打开mysql以空密码登录 9、修改密码set password for root@localhost=password('password'); //password为要设置的密码 10、退出mysql,重新配置就不会出现1045错误了) 声明:ITeye文章版权属于作者,受法律保护。没有作者书面许可不得转载。
推荐链接
|
|
返回顶楼 | |
发表时间:2010-07-25
这不是解决1045,而是如何处理忘记root密码的问题。
|
|
返回顶楼 | |
发表时间:2010-07-26
whitesock 写道 这不是解决1045,而是如何处理忘记root密码的问题。
我在安装mysql完成后在接着配置设置,在配置设置的过程中就出现了该项错误"mysql error nr.1045",然后我用上面我所说的方法去解决的时候,就解决了 |
|
返回顶楼 | |
发表时间:2010-07-26
skip-grant-tables除了禁止加载privilege table之外,还会禁止动态加载的plugin(例如InnoDB Plugin), 慎用。
|
|
返回顶楼 | |